EX2) Identify the constant of proportionality in the equation y=15x where
y = 15 x
k = constant of proportionalityy = k x
15 = constant of proportionality
Explain the relationship. y = cost of concert tickets and x = number of concert tickets
Each concert ticket cost $15.
